I've been building Android images in my spare time and running them on my phone. Anyway anyone out there want to share their tips or tricks on building Android for the Vogue. Things such as what to put in .repo/local_manifest.xml.

Also is anyone working on getting the hero rom working with the vogue. I've tried but only get as far as having the htc boot logo loop. And if I put the contents of app_s in /system/app I get no boot logo but a bunch of permission errors.

You have to watch which hero build you're trying to use. Many of them use apps2sd which will cause issues if you don't have you sd card partitioned. I worked on a couple of them for a while with limited success but what I did get running was much too slow to work with. However the released files are from a very early build and as such there are alot of force closes etc. Hopefully HTC will drop a hero phone sometime soon with a complete build, which will make the process much easier.
